Citrus Sunrise
Do you love the smell of citrus fruits? This refreshing blend is perfect for starting your day or enjoying hot summer days.
It’s perfect for energizing your day and boosting your mood. This is a great blend because it’s a light scent and usually doesn’t bother people who can be sensitive to smells.
What You Need:
- 3 Drops of Vetiver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Lemon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Lavender Essential Oil
Pina Colada
Looking for a fun, summery diffuser blend? Check out this recipe for a Pina Colada oil diffuser blend! This blend is perfect for adding a touch of tropical flavor to your home. Plus, it’s great for boosting your mood and energy levels. You’ll need 5 Drops of lemon oil, 2 drops of copaiba oil and 3 drops of stress away oil.
What You Need
- 5 Drops of Lemon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Copaiba Essential Oil
- 3 Drops Stress Away Essential Oil
Fresh Herb Garden
It’s that time of year again where the weather is warming up and the abundance of fresh herbs are starting to grow. But if you don’t have a green thumb, you can still create that natural fresh scent in your home with this diffuser combo.
What You Need:
- 2 drops of Rosemary Essential Oil
- 2 drops of Lemon Essential Oil
- 2 drops of Thyme Essential Oil
- 1 drop Spearmint Essential Oil
Island Time

Have you ever wished you could bottle up the smell of a tropical island and take it with you wherever you go? Now, with just a few simple ingredients, you can create your own essential oil blend that will transport you to paradise every time you use it. This blend is perfect for diffusing in your home or office, or even adding a few drops to your bath water for an extra-relaxing experience. Make your home smell like a vacation every day.
What You Need:
- 2 Drops Lime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Ginger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Sweet Orange Essential Oil
- 1 Drop Ylang Ylang Essential Oil
Fresh Cut Flowers

It’s hard to resist the allure of fresh flowers. They smell amazing and add a touch of brightness to any room. Wouldn’t it be great if you could have that same scent in your home all the time? Well, with this essential oil blend, you can! This recipe uses a combination of floral essential oils to create a fragrance that is reminiscent of fresh cut flowers. Not only will it make your house smell heavenly, but it will also promote feelings of peace and relaxation.
What You Need:
- 2 Drops Lavender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Bergamont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Lemon Essential Oil
- 2 Drops Geranium Essential Oil
Lemonade Stand

Summertime is the perfect time to enjoy all things lemonade! This essential oil blend recipe smells just like a lemonade stand and is perfect for enjoying the refreshing scent all summer long. Now you can have the fresh scents of summer in your living room all year long.
What You Need:
- 4 Drops Lemon Essential Oil
- 1 Drop Spearmint Essential Oil
- 1 Drop Basil Essential Oil

Hawaii
You can’t get more summery and tropical than Hawaii. Use Hawiian sandalwood with a couple of drops of lime for this zingy essential oil blend that is just like summer.
What you need
- 2 drops lime essential oil
- 3 drops royal Hawaiian sandalwood essential oil
Summer Citrus
Four citrus essential oils mixed with a drop of bergamot makes this essential oil blend ideal for hot summery days, and a fun lively atmosphere with friends.

What you need
- 1 drop sweet orange
- 1 drop lemon
- 1 drop lime
- 1 drop pink grapefruit
- 1 drop bergamot
Fresh Jasmine
This sweet floral scent with jasmine, rose and vanilla is perfect for setting the mood for summer romance.

What you need
- 6 drops jasmine
- 6 drops rose
- 2 drops vanilla
Summer Energizer
Want to get woken up, lively and active then this is the summer blend for you.
What you need
- 2 drops wintergreen
- 2 drops lemongrass
- 2 drops orange
Summer Relaxation
This refreshing essential oils blend conjures up vibes of a lavender field in the summer, refreshing and relaxing.

What you need
- 3 drops lavender
- 2 drops lemongrass
- 1 drop peppermint
Summer Woodland
This blend has a woody outdoor scent for summer woodland and wholesome campfire vibes
What you need
- 2 drops cypress
- 1 drop sandalwood
- 1 drop juniper berry

But make sure that if you plan on using them on your skin, you use a carrier oil
Carrier oils are used to dilute the essential oils and carry them to your skin. You do not want to put the undiluted oils directly onto your skin as this will be too strong and irritate or even burn your skin.
